Jingwen Gong Inducted into National English Honor Society at Randolph-Macon Academy

2014 Jun 9

Jingwen Gong, the daughter of Mr. Gong and Mrs. Zhang of Beijing, was inducted into Randolph-Macon Academy's chapter of the National English Honor Society on April 25, 2014. Alice is a sophomore at Randolph-Macon Academy.

To be selected for the National English Honor Society, a student must have completed at least one semester of Honors or AP English and earned at least a grade point average of 3.5, including an average of at least 3.7 in Honors and AP English courses. The student must also have attended R-MA for at least one semester and display exemplary conduct and honor.

Randolph-Macon Academy (R-MA), founded in 1892, is a college-preparatory, coeducational boarding school for students in grades 6 through 12. Students in grades 9-12 participate in R-MA's 91st Air Force Junior Reserve Officer Training Corps (JROTC), which is currently recognized as an Outstanding Unit. R-MA is affiliated with the United Methodist Church and is located in Front Royal, VA.
